Our Gate Parts & Welding Services in West Springfield

Post Replacement

West Springfield sits in the Connecticut River valley, and the frost depth here routinely hits three to four feet. Posts set in shallow footings heave every spring. We’ve replaced frost-heaved posts on ranch properties off Amostown Road where the gate post had tilted a full six inches out of plumb. A proper West Springfield post replacement means digging to below frost line, setting the post in a four-foot concrete footing, and re-hanging the gate leaf so it swings true again. Post replacement work here typically runs $500-$1,200 depending on gate size and how far below grade we need to go.

Post Replacement

Hinge Replacement

Most hinge failures in West Springfield are on 50-to-70-year-old painted steel and ornamental iron gates that were installed with the house. The hinge itself rusts through or the weld cracks at the post. We weld new hinge plates on site, which means we don’t have to haul your gate to a shop and leave your driveway open. For a standard residential swing gate, hinge replacement runs $180-$450. If the post has shifted too, we’ll tell you honestly that replacing the hinge alone won’t fix the sag, because a gate sags in the hinge post, not in the middle.

Rail Repair

Ranch-style gates on the older streets of West Springfield, especially the split-levels and capes built between 1945 and 1975, commonly fail at the rail joints. A bottom rail rusts through, or the diagonal brace cracks at the weld. We cut out the bad section, fabricate a matching rail on site, and weld it in. Rail repair typically runs $220-$520 depending on how much of the rail needs replacing and whether the gate frame is steel or aluminum. Fix the panel without the post and you’ll fix it twice, so we always check the hinge post before we start welding.

Common Gate Parts & Welding Problems We See in West Springfield Homes

  • Frost-heaved posts on spring thaw. The Connecticut River valley gets deeper frost than coastal Massachusetts, and every March and April we get calls from West Springfield homeowners whose swing gates suddenly jam because a post shifted over the winter. The fix is a deeper footing, not just re-hanging the gate.
  • Rusted-through hinge posts on 1950s and 1960s ranch gates. The original ornamental iron and chain-link driveway gates in neighborhoods like Tatham have been in the ground for 50 to 70 years. The steel rusts at the base where the post meets the soil, and the hinge tears loose. We weld new hinge mounts and replace the post if it’s compromised.
  • Worn rack and pinion components on heavy gates. Commercial and agricultural gates along Boulevard and Memorial Avenue, especially around The Big E grounds, wear out rack and pinion hardware faster than residential systems. We keep replacement rack sections and pinion gears in stock for that reason.
  • Spring snowmelt corrosion at hinges and latches. When the snow melts off the valley slopes and pools along fence lines, hinge pins and latch hardware sit in water and corrode. A gate that worked fine in October seizes by April. We replace corroded hardware with sealed or greasable fittings where possible.
